概括
对叙事反的自动化文本分析改善了医疗学员和教育工作者的解释. 这种方法通过构建反主题和情绪来增强学习,指导和评估.
科学领域:
- 医疗教育 医学教育
- 计算语言学 计算语言学
- 心理测量 心理测量 心理测量
背景情况:
- 叙事反对于学习,指导和评估中的决策至关重要.
- 解释叙事反可能是具有挑战性和耗时的,阻碍了评估数据的有效使用.
- 需要支持学习者,教练和决策者有效地使用和解释叙事反.
研究的目的:
- 探索自动化文本分析对解释叙事评估数据的有用性.
- 在叙事评估中识别主导反主题和情绪极性.
- 检查反极性,绩效分数和任务判断之间的关联.
主要方法:
- 应用了主题建模和情绪分析,对80名学员的926项临床评估进行了评估.
- 利用自动化技术来识别反主题 (医疗技能,知识,沟通和专业性) 和情绪极性.
- 检查了反情绪,数值绩效得分和整体判断之间的相关性.
主要成果:
- 主题建模确定了三个关键的反主题.
- 评估人员向不符合能力标准的实习生提供了更详细的反.
- 在平均绩效分数和平均情绪极性之间发现了强烈的正相关性,尽管不是在单一评估层面.
结论:
- 自动化文本分析可以带来更高效,结构化和有意义的评估体验.
- 这些技术可以通过帮助解释来促进对评估数据的更深入的对话.
- 进一步的研究对于将自动化文本分析纳入教育实践至关重要,以获得最大的益处.
